Manager, Payroll Operations



Job description

 

 

 

Requisition ID: 239241  



We are committed to investing in our employees and helping you continue your career at ScotiaGBS
 

 

 

Purpose

 

Responsible for leading and managing a team of Payroll Analysts in completing activities related to the payroll processes.

This role acts as an escalation point in processing ROE Data, resolving inquiries through the Case Mangement system, employee claims, leave data discrepancies/errors, and ensures all activities are complete in accordance with the Bank’s policies and procedures, and standard regulations.

 

Accountabilities 

•    Leads and drives a customer focused culture throughout their team to deepen client relationships and leverage broader Bank relationships, systems and knowledge

•    Provides day-to-day guidance to Payroll Analysts on the proper usage of the case management systems to drive accurate, effective and efficient responses to inquiries from internal and external partners regarding Time & Payroll policies and procedures.

•    Leads and manages the team of Payroll Analysts in assisting with activities related to the payroll and time processes

•    Facilitates the completion of the Record of Employments (ROE’s) on a bi-weekly or as needed basis  

•    Facilitates with the investigation of time/leave data discrepancies/errors, resolves errors as required 

•    Holds self and team accountable for ensuring the accurate administration, remittance and reporting of payroll related activities in compliance with relevant employment standards and legislations

•    Provides leadership, guidance, and prioritization for all activities 

•    Provides expertise on matters related to payroll and time, resolves escalated medium risk inquiries or concerns 

•    Seeks opportunities to improve/enhance payroll processes and delivery, provides insights and recommending solutions to Sr. Manager, Payroll 

•    Assist with managing the bi-weekly payroll process using the SAP Payroll System on an as needed basis

•    Completes month-end and year-end closings and respective summary reporting on an as needed basis

•    Understands how the Bank’s risk appetite and risk culture should be considered in day-to-day activities and decisions

•    Creates an environment in which his/her team pursues effective and efficient operations within his/her respective areas, while ensuring the adequacy, adherence to and effectiveness of day-to-day business controls to meet obligations with respect to operational risk, regulatory compliance risk, AML/ATF risk and conduct risk, including but not limited to responsibilities under the Operational Risk Management Framework, Regulatory Compliance Risk Management Framework, AML/ATF Global Handbook and the Guidelines for Business Conduct 

•    Builds a high performance environment and implements a people strategy that attracts, retains, develops and motivates their team by fostering an inclusive work environment; communicating vison/values/business strategy and managing succession and development planning for the team 

Reporting Relationships 
Primary Manager:    •    Sr. Manager, Payroll
Direct Reports:    •    Payroll Analyst

 

Dimensions

•    Manages 3 to 6 direct reports     
•    Assist with the accurate and timely processing of payroll and time related activities
•    Manages support of HR Systems including: WorkForce System,  Case Management Systems, SAP Payroll, SAP SuccessFactors (me@Scotiabank)
•    Ensures business continuity for accountabilities under purview, ensuring coverage 5 days/week in assigned schedules (EST)
•    Significant volume of transactions
•    Services a global community and responds within SLAs timeframe
•    Ensures activities are in compliance with relevant employment standards and legislations                 

 

Education / Experience

•    2 to 5 years of prior experience in a supervisory for leadership role
•    Post-secondary degree in Business or Human Resources or pursuing education in related field
•    Prior customer service is an asset 
•    Knowledge of HR foundations
•    Deep understanding of Bank policies and procedures
•    Strong knowledge of organizational structure and complexity
•    People leadership skills including mentoring and training 
•    Strong verbal & written communication skills (English/Spanish) - Required
•    Proven teamwork capabilities; strong relationship management and interpersonal skills
•    Strong planning and organizational skills
•    Strong and very solid analytical skills, problem solving, critical thinking, and detailed oriented.
•    Advanced knowledge of Excel and proficient knowledge of Power Point, and Word.
•    Ability to deal with conflict resolution and different personalities
•    Attentive to details and deadlines; ability to manage multiple initiatives
•    Must exhibit good judgment and authority, along with skills to provide solutions and expertise 
                                        

Working Conditions
Work in a standard office-based environment; non-standard hours are a common occurrence.

Limited travel domestically.
